Step-by-step explanation:
First, set up the equations.
plan 1: initial fee of $55.96, $0.12 per mile
plan 2: initial fee of $63.96, $0.08 per mile
We want to know at what distance will the cost be the same. So, set the equations equal to each other.
0.12x + 55.96 = 0.08x + 63.96
Combine the variables.
0.04x + 55.96 = 63.96
Combine the constants.
0.04x = 8
Divide by 0.04 to isolate x.
x = 200 miles
Check by plugging x back into each equation.
y = 0.12(200) + 55.96
y = 24 + 55.96
y = $79.96
y = 0.08(200) + 63.96
y = 16 + 63.96
y = $79.96
